CalDAV and Profile Manager question
I am attempting to set up CalDAV in Profile Manager for our mobile devices. I am applying these settings to a group. I can't complete configuring the CalDAV payload because Profile Manager tells me that a CalDAV username is required. Again, this profile is for a group, so each user should be entering his own username to connect to his personal calendar. I've included a screenshot below to illustrate what's happening.
Is there something I'm misunderstanding about how CalDAV needs to be configured, or is this a bug?
Hi Adams,
You can use variables keys in Profile Manager to push groups settings
(I don't know if this list is exhaustive or not)
User keys:
email
full_name
guid
short_name
first_name
last_name
job_title
mobile_phone
uid
Device keys:
udid
device_type
guid
scep_uuid
scep_challenge
reg_cert
reg_cert_uuid
reg_challenge
mdm_cert
mdm_cert_uuid
mdm_challenge
user_id
pending_user_id
token
unlock_token
push_magic
last_checkin_time
Version
Serial
Product
ProductName
PhoneNumber
DeviceName
OSVersion
BuildVersion
ModelName
Model
SerialNumber
DeviceCapacity
AvailableDeviceCapacity
IMEI
MEID
JailbreakDetected
ModemFirmwareVersion
Query
ICCID
BluetoothMAC
WiFiMAC
CurrentCarrierNetwork
SIMCarrierNetwork
CarrierSettingsVersion

Error reading settings in wiki and profile manager
I have just upgraded from Snow Leopard Server to Lion server.
I now have the following errors in server app:-
Wiki : message "Error Reading Settings"
Profile Manager: message "Error Reading Settings"
What do I do to get my wiki back!
When I visit my default ssl Wiki I get the following:-
Collaboration::PGCConnectionError in Sources#index
Showing /usr/share/collabd/coreclient/app/views/layouts/application.html.erb where line #5 raised:
FATAL: role "collab" does not exist
Extracted source (around line #5):
2: :user => @user,3: :entity => @entity,4: :owner => @owner,5: :service_client => service_client,6: :controller => controller7: }) %>8:
Rails.root: /usr/share/collabd/coreclient
Application Trace | Framework Trace | Full Traceapp/controllers/application_controller.rb:325:in `service_client'app/views/layouts/application.html.erb:5:in `_app_views_layouts_application_html_erb___1616978790_2215846900_0'app/controllers/application_controller.rb:44:in `render_server_error'app/controllers/application_controller.rb:43:in `render_server_error'
Request
Parameters:
None
Show session dump
Show env dump
Response
Headers:
None
Please helpI did a clean install of Lion/Lion Server, but I ran ino the same problem too with "Error Reading Settings" for both the profile manager and the wiki.
INVESTIGATION: I checked to see if the postgres database (which I presumed was were the settings were being read from).
# sudo serveradmin fullstatus postgres
postgres:dataDirHasBeenInitialized = yes
postgres:PG_VERSION = "9.0.4"
postgres:dataDir = "/var/pgsql"
postgres:postgresIsResponding = no # !!! why isn't it responding???
postgres:dataDirIsDirectory = yes
postgres:PGserverVersion = 0
postgres:dataDirExists = yes
postgres:setStateVersion = 1
postgres:state = "RUNNING"
PROBLEM: The postgres service hadn't been started properly; I found this by doing the following:
# sudo serveradmin stop postgres
postgres:state = "STOPPED"
# sudo serveradmin start postgres
postgres:error = "CANNOT_START_SERVICE_TIMEOUT_ERR"
FIX: The postgres service couldn't create the log file because it didn't have permission. I did this to fix it, then simply restarted it and all was well:
# sudo chmod 777 /Library/Logs/
# sudo serveradmin start postgres
postgres:state = "RUNNING"
I hope this helps someone. -
Yosemite Server Signed Certificate vs OD and Profile Manager
Hello Again,
For more info on my setup follow the thread exchange Yosemite Server forward zone vs SSL types
I've purchased a Comodo Positive SSL that covers www.example.com and example.com
I asked OS X Server to use it and it went on to set up this Comodo signed Certificates up for Calendar, Mail (Pop and iMAP), Mail (SMTP), Messages and Websites.....
... But not for Open Directory which uses the xyz.example.com OD Intermediate CA.
In Profile Manager, Configuration Profile Sections, I have checked "Sign Configuration Profile" and the only choice if I click the "edit" button is the "xyz.example.com OD Intermediate CA".
1- Should OD use the Comodo Certificate like all other services?
2- Will the Comodo certificate appear in the Profile Manager If I tell OD to use it?
FrancoisSorry Here,
Hope I understand this correctly.
The Comodo Positive SSL is a Web certificate. Although I ask OD to use it, it didn't.
Then Profile Manager expects a "code signing" certificate which is why all it saw was Open Directory's one.
